Abstract
Treatment of wastewater containing complex copper is difficulty and hotspot in the field of environment engineering. High concentration of Cu2+ on complexation is difficulty to be removed. In the paper, ferrate was used to treat wastewater containing complex copper and spot manufacturing methods of ferrate (Na2FeO4) was specifically introduced. Orthogonal experiment, three important effective factors such as pH, dosage and reaction time were studied. The result shows that removal efficiency of copper complex can reach 99.1% when pH is 14,reaction time is 30 min and dosage is 300 mg/L, and effluent quality meet class 1 of national discharge standard. In summation, complex copper wastewater treated by ferrate is a practical technique and will have a good prospect.关键词
